Nourishing Your Heart: Essential Vitamins To Eat

A healthy heart is essential for overall well-being, and certain vitamins play a crucial role in supporting cardiovascular health. Incorporating these vital nutrients into your diet can strengthen your heart and reduce the risk of heart disease. Some of the best vitamins to include in your food intake are vitamin C, vitamin E, B vitamins, and potassium.

  • Vitamin C is a potent antioxidant that counters free radicals, which can damage blood vessels. Leafy greens are excellent sources of vitamin C.
  • Vitamin E also acts as an antioxidant and helps reduce bad cholesterol levels. Nuts, seeds, and vegetable oils are rich in vitamin E.
  • B Vitamins play a vital role in creating energy and maintaining healthy blood flow. Whole grains, legumes, and poultry are good sources of B vitamins.
  • Potassium helps regulate blood pressure and reduce the risk of stroke. Bananas, potatoes, and avocados are good sources of potassium.

By incorporateing a balanced diet rich in these heart-healthy vitamins, you can take significant steps towards protecting your cardiovascular system and living a longer, healthier life.

Heart-Healthy Habits: Vitamins and Minerals for a Strong Cardiovascular System

A robust cardiovascular system is vital for overall well-being. Including a balanced diet rich in essential vitamins and minerals can significantly contribute to maintaining a healthy heart. Some crucial nutrients that bolster cardiovascular health include potassium, which helps control blood pressure; magnesium, critical in muscle and nerve function, including those of the heart; and vitamin C, a powerful antioxidant that safeguards blood vessels from more info damage. Moreover, B vitamins play a key role in processing power from food and facilitating healthy red blood cell production, vital for oxygen delivery throughout the body.

Focusing on a diet abundant in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ean protein sources, and healthy fats can guarantee your body with the necessary vitamins and minerals to support a strong and efficient cardiovascular system.
